First Serenade Band, Kassav, Marce et Tumpak have been added to the lineup for the 2018 World Creole Music Festival (WCMF). Acting Events Manager Marva Williams announced the new additions at a press update on the WCMF Promotions on Wednesday August 29, 2018 at the Prevost Cinemall. Kassav a band was formed in Guadeloupe. First Serenade from Point Mitchel is one of Dominica’s most recognized bands. Marce et Tumpak is a Martinican band known for their energy and excitement. Miss William says this year’s World Creole Music Festival is expected to be bigger and better, especially in the aftermath of Hurricane Maria. She advised patrons and visitors to purchase their tickets early. The World Creole Music festival is carded for October 26 to 28, 2018. She also announced this year’s line-up, which will see Movado, Kassav, Yemi Alade, Triple Kay International, Klass and the First Serenade Band, performing on ‘night-one’ Friday.
